Transaction 583b31417166d1445daa7c30cc3161b529c03598a10eaecbbb30ec039f5b8808

2 Input
2 Outputs
  • 583b31417166d1445daa7c30cc3161b529c03598a10eaecbbb30ec039f5b8808:0
  • value  41663
    address  1H7YSRQ8aiCM8decUZ8uqk61DPka6NjELi
  • 583b31417166d1445daa7c30cc3161b529c03598a10eaecbbb30ec039f5b8808:1
  • value  7479378
    address  1EQi3biTfGL7uBVdoe48QYZn5o8cRo23gk